Southern Cornbread Ham Salad

This recipe for Southern cornbread ham salad is a perfect hearty supper salad, and is a great way to use up leftover ham!

Ingredients

Scale

For the dressing

  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 2 teaspoons chopped fresh parsley
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 3/4 cup milk

For the salad

  • 1 package of cornbread mix (we love Jiffy!)
  • 1 cup corn kernels
  • 1 cup diced tomatoes
  • 8 ounces ham, cut into bite sized pieces

Instructions

  1. Mix all dressing ingredients together and set aside.
  2. Bake cornbread according to package directions.
  3. Let the cornbread cool, and then crumble into bite sized pieces.
  4. Put the cornbread crumbles into a serving bowl and add the corn, tomatoes and ham and toss gently. 
  5. Add the dressing in spoonfuls, tasting as you go, until it is dressed to your liking.
  6. Divide among plates and serve it up!
